Look at the Cottage at Crystal lake. It is off MacArthur with easy access to the I-295. I can get to my job in about 20 minutes. If you live in fayetteville you will need to try to avoid the All American gate. Traffic is bad there. You can have up to a 30 wait at that gate. I use the Butner Gate. I almost never wait but a few minutes. Next week look at Bragg on google maps with the traffic overlay on. You will see what I am talking about.

Village on the lake has been by far the best for the price that I've lived at in the past 4 years. It's in Spring Lake and about 15 min from Randolph gate. I've lived in 2 other apartments since being stationed at Bragg and haven't had one come close to living here. Randolph gate is never busy. The apartment includes door side trash pick up, water, a pool, wifi, and cable for 1040 a month. You only pay for electric.
